diff options
author | Ekaitz Zarraga <ekaitz@elenq.tech> | 2025-08-22 00:38:36 +0200 |
---|---|---|
committer | Ekaitz Zarraga <ekaitz@elenq.tech> | 2025-08-22 00:38:36 +0200 |
commit | 39dd684496a6750a2458873e3c736bd8569e8db0 (patch) | |
tree | 171f2d0ab8094eb83e183e64de4385260ea228cd /src/piece-table.c | |
parent | ebb4cc5b97b8565ceffa0d48301f8af9e6b884df (diff) |
text-buffer: Add `text_buffer_append_str` function
Diffstat (limited to 'src/piece-table.c')
-rw-r--r-- | src/piece-table.c | 6 |
1 files changed, 1 insertions, 5 deletions
diff --git a/src/piece-table.c b/src/piece-table.c index 070d265..14f456f 100644 --- a/src/piece-table.c +++ b/src/piece-table.c @@ -159,15 +159,11 @@ void piece_table_insert (piece_table *pt, size_t pos, char *in, size_t len) { piece *start, *end, *new; - size_t i; assert ( pos <= pt->length ); assert ( len > 0 ); - for (i=0; i<len; i++) - { - text_buffer_append (&pt->add, in[i]); - } + text_buffer_append_str (&pt->add, in, len); if ( pos == 0 ) { |